| Episode narrativeepisode_narrative | High pressure rebuilt into central California on November 17. Clear skies, light winds and inversion conditions over the San Joaquin Valley followed on the morning of November 18 and reduced visibility to below 500 feet across much of the valley north of Kern County. The dense fog fog resulted in several school districts either opening late or cancelling bus service. The fog lifted into a low cloud deck by late morning which dissipated by early afternoon. |
| Event narrativeevent_narrative | Visibility below a quarter mile was reported in Visalia. Several school districts either opened late or delayed or cancelled bus service. |
